The Maryland Institute College of Art (MICA) is a private art and design college in Baltimore, Maryland. Founded in 1826 as the Maryland Institute for the Promotion of the Mechanic Arts, it is regarded as one of the oldest art colleges in the United States.

Maryland Institute College of Art is a private institution that was founded in 1826. It has a total undergraduate enrollment of 1,403 (fall 2023), and the campus size is 16 acres.
Maryland Institute College of Art (MICA) offers 16 undergraduate majors, 2 liberal arts (or academic) majors, and 18 studio concentrations, including: Animation; Product design; Art History, Theory and Criticism; Painting; And many more majors, listed here.
